當前位置:名人名言大全網 - 短信平臺 - php如何調用api接口,主要是php調用聯通,移動api進行短信的發送?

php如何調用api接口,主要是php調用聯通,移動api進行短信的發送?

妳沒法調移動。聯通api的,如果要進行短信發送,可以去找短信接口,壹般去運營商購買,然後他們提供api。然後用php對接即可,很簡單,比如下面使用的就是某家的api發送:

$this->content = “發送內容”;

$this->name = "短信賬號";

$this->pwd= "短信密碼";

$this->mobile = "發送的手機號";

$argv = array(

'name'=>$this->name, //必填參數。用戶賬號

'pwd'=>$this->pwd, //必填參數。(web平臺:基本資料中的接口密碼)

'content'=>$this->content, //必填參數。發送內容(1-500 個漢字)UTF-8編碼

'mobile'=>$this->mobile, //必填參數。手機號碼。多個以英文逗號隔開

'stime'=>'', //可選參數。發送時間,填寫時已填寫的時間發送,不填時為當前時間發送

'sign'=>$this->sign, //必填參數。用戶簽名。

'type'=>$this->type, //必填參數。固定值 pt

'extno'=>$this->extno //可選參數,擴展碼,用戶定義擴展碼,只能為數字

);

//構造要post的字符串

foreach ($argv as $key=>$value) {

if ($flag!=0) {

$params .= "&";

$flag = 1;

}

$params.= $key."=";

$params.= urlencode($value);

$flag = 1;

}

$url = "?".$params; //提交的url

$resultUrl = file_get_contents($url);//獲取發送狀態